Our centres fall under three distinct categories and undertake research of strategic importance. They include: Flagship, Impact and Incubator.

Flagship centres

These centres conduct world-leading research to address significant, long-term challenges and are focused on delivering outcomes through the execution of multiple research programmes in their defined field.

Impact centres

Impact centres focus on specific areas of health and medical research of national significance. They deliver concentrated expertise on one or two subjects within their defined research area.

Incubators

Incubators identify a societal need and look to test their research capabilities to meet the challenge of addressing it. They bring together researchers who may not otherwise collaborate, to take a risk on a new idea with the potential for significant community impact.

Other research groups and initiatives

The NHMRC Centres of Research Excellence grant program provides support for teams of researchers to pursue collaborative research and develop capacity in clinical, population health and health services research. 

We are home to a number of these centres and support the conduct and development of innovative, high-quality and collaborative research.
